Larbrax  Dumfries and Galloway, SCOTLAND
Climbs 19 – Rocktype Greywacke – Altitude 3m a.s.l – Faces S
Crag features
The crag consists of three slabs alongside each other: The Seaward, Central and Right Slabs. In addition there is bouldering to be had on the beach by the main crag including on the obvious pinnacle.

Access notes
Access is down a track past Larbrax farm which leads through a number of gates to the beach. Head north along the beach (easiest at high tide although not necessary) for about 1km.
